begin process at 2012 05 30 04:23:57
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ive Javascript

 > 

Archives

 > 

Trucs & Astuces

 > 

texte déroulant (qui apparait ou disparait) ... probleme de clic


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

texte déroulant (qui apparait ou disparait) ... probleme de clic

vendredi 17 juin 2005 à 21:43:54 | texte déroulant (qui apparait ou disparait) ... probleme de clic

glipper

Membre Club
Bonjour,
je souhaite faire un menu qui puisse "apparaitre" ou "disparaitre" lorsqu'on clique sur un lien. Le code ci-dessous fonctionne à peu près, mais un petit probleme persiste : il est nécessaire de cliquer deux fois avant que le menu apparaisse ou disparaisse. Le premier clic remonte en haut de la page mais ne fais rien... il faut en faire un second pour que ça fonctionne. Est-ce normal ? N'y a t'il pas moyen d'eviter ça ?
Merci d'avance pour vos réponses...

Le code:

<script language="javascript">
function look(a,idx){
document.getElementById(idx).style.display=document.getElementById(idx).style.display=='block'?"none":"block";
}
</script>

<a href="#" id="Lien1" onClick='look(this.id,"Text1Depliant")';> ... </a>
<div id="Text1Depliant" style="display:yes;"> ...
</div>


Glipper
samedi 18 juin 2005 à 10:07:31 | Re : texte déroulant (qui apparait ou disparait) ... probleme de clic

bultez

Membre Club
Réponse acceptée !

Bonjour,
c'était pas loin ...

<HTML>
<TITLE></TITLE>
<HEAD>
<script type="text/javascript">
function look(idx)
{
var sd=document.getElementById(idx).style;
sd.display=sd.display=='inline'?"none":"inline";
}
</script>
</HEAD>
<BODY>
<div id="Text1Depliant"
  style="display:inline">exemple...</div>
<a  href="javascript:void(look('Text1Depliant'));">lien...</a><br/>
</BODY>
</HTML>

j'ai mis inline, block serait presque pareil
Cordialement. Bul. ~Site~~Mail~



Cette discussion est classée dans : clic, style, probleme, display, idx


Répondre à ce message

Sujets en rapport avec ce message

Display:block/inline et firefox (mozilla) [ par romalafrite ] salut à tous, petit problème. j'ai un petit script que j'ai fait : function ShowHide(thisdiv) { if (thisdiv.style.display=='none') { thisdiv.style.dis "Disable" tableau dans sous menu [ par toutatix ] bonjour,j ai trouve sur un site internet un script pour menu et sous menu.Je l ai adapte pour ma page.Le script marche super, menu et sous menu appara Clic et double clic dans un tableau [ par nougitch ] Bonjour, Je possède un tableau. J'aimerai que quand je clique sur une donnée elle se colore. Quand quand je reclique dessus, elle retrouve sa couleur problème de div [ par algori ] Bonjour,Voilà, mon problème est qu'il se génère une erreur dans le script suivant quand j'essaie de fermer ma checkbox. Je suppose que l'erreur est si Cacher Masquer un groupe de Div [ par fdthierry ] Bonjour,J'utilise ce code java:function ShowHideMenu(Div) {   if (Div.style.display=='none') {     Div.style.display='InLine';    }  &nbsp Javascript menu deroulant [ par RM50Man ] C'est un menu déroulant !!!!Quelqu'un pourrait me dire comment faire pour qu'il n'y est^pas d'espace entre le Menu Presentation et classeet comment fa probleme sous mozilla ?(double action sur 1 clic...) [ par floxone ] Salut, j'ai un probleme avec le clic sur une image.Mon script est du type : Ce script marche sur IE, mais pas sur Mozilla...Une idée ?Ai probleme de valeur pour style.display (affichage d'une deuxieme liste en fonction du onchange de la première) [ par mageonyme ] salut,j'ai un pb avec le script ci-dessous, et j'arrive pas à comprendre pkoi ?effect desiré : normalement si on choisi dans la liste id_metier, la li Retardement pour style.display [ par mageonyme ] salut,voilà mon pb : je voudrais que la partie "else{ }" de cette fonction ne fonctionne qu'après un certain temps genre 2 secondes (en gros c'est pôu Code javascript non clair. [ par CHABRY ] Bonjour je me demande que font les oéprations suivantes: function valid(val) { if (typeof(val.display) == "string") { if (val.display


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,295 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ales